Analysis

The most recent figure for completion rate, lower secondary education, female (modelled data) in United States of America is 99.2%, measured in 2025. That is the highest value across all 45 years on record.

That represents a change of up 0.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, completion rate, lower secondary education, female (modelled data) in United States of America peaked at 99.2% in 2025 and was at its lowest, 94.8%, in 1981.

That places United States of America 26th out of 164 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 45 years of available data.

Completion rate, lower secondary education, female (modelled data) in United States of America, year by year

Annual values for Completion rate, lower secondary education, female (modelled data) (%) in United States of America, 1981 to 2025.
Year % Change
1981 94.8%
1982 94.9% +0.1%
1983 94.9% +0.1%
1984 95.0% +0.0%
1985 95.0% +0.0%
1986 95.1% +0.1%
1987 95.2% +0.1%
1988 95.2% +0.0%
1989 95.3% +0.0%
1990 95.2% -0.0%
1991 95.2% +0.0%
1992 95.3% +0.0%
1993 95.3% +0.1%
1994 95.5% +0.1%
1995 95.6% +0.2%
1996 95.9% +0.3%
1997 96.2% +0.3%
1998 96.4% +0.2%
1999 96.6% +0.2%
2000 96.8% +0.2%
2001 97.0% +0.2%
2002 97.2% +0.2%
2003 97.4% +0.2%
2004 97.7% +0.3%
2005 97.9% +0.2%
2006 98.1% +0.2%
2007 98.3% +0.2%
2008 98.4% +0.2%
2009 98.5% +0.1%
2010 98.6% +0.1%
2011 98.6% +0.1%
2012 98.7% +0.1%
2013 98.8% +0.1%
2014 98.9% +0.1%
2015 98.9% +0.0%
2016 98.9% -0.0%
2017 98.9% -0.0%
2018 98.9% +0.0%
2019 99.0% +0.0%
2020 99.0% +0.0%
2021 99.0% +0.0%
2022 99.1% +0.0%
2023 99.1% +0.0%
2024 99.1% +0.0%
2025 99.2% +0.0%
